Jobs found
Manager - Sustainability E-446
Mumbai
Informa Markets
(EP200) Manager - Sustainability
Mumbai
Informa Markets
Manager - Sustainability KB596
Mumbai
Informa Markets
(CUK919) - Manager - Sustainability
Mumbai
Informa Markets
Agro Sales Executive | [CY613]
Mumbai
Datrax Services